As the manager of a 90-unit motel you know that all units are occupied when you charge $120 a day per unit. Each occupied room costs $68 for service and maintenance a day. You have also observed that for every 2x dollars increase in the daily rate above $120, there are 3x units vacant. Determine the daily price that you should charge in order to maximize profit. Calculate the number of occupied units. Assuming that fixed cost is $704 calculate optimal profit.
